Readin' 'Ritin' and Rhythmetic is a 1948 Screen Songs cartoon directed by Seymour Kneitel and Al Eugster.
The original vocal track recording for "Readin, 'Ritin', and Rhythmetic" (1948).
One of the Screen Songs produced in Polacolor. Thought to be lost for decades (it was never part of the TV package), this release marks its first appearance maybe since its original release.
